How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cumberlnd Ctr?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cumberlnd Ctr Studio Apartments | $2,050 | $1,174 | $2,650 |
| Cumberlnd Ctr 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,279 | $1,326 | $3,695 |
| Cumberlnd Ctr 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,554 | $1,444 | $4,345 |
| Cumberlnd Ctr 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,606 | $1,937 | $3,600 |
| Cumberlnd Ctr 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,015 | $2,836 | $3,195 |
